An unexpected plant rescue haul 🌿

These beauties (and more) were thrown away by someone my mum knows because of fungus gnats (yes with pots)… so of course she rescued them and shared some with me 🥹

Fungus gnats live in the soil, so I’ve removed all the old compost, washed the roots, cleaned the pots properly, and treated everything with neem oil (found a few mealybugs hiding too 👀).

Spider plants usually hate terrariums… yet this one is absolutely thriving 🤯🌿
Roots are happy, growth is wild, and the babies keep coming.

What seems to be working:
🌱 Excellent drainage – deep substrate layers so roots never sit soggy
🌬️ Air flow – this terrarium isn’t sealed, so moisture can escape
✂️ Regular grooming – older leaves and excess growth are trimmed to prevent rot and crowding
💡Bright, indirect light – enough energy without cooking the leaves
